Basic programming
Subject is not scheduled Not scheduled
| Code | Completion | Credits | Range | Language Instruction | Semester |
|---|---|---|---|---|---|
| 373ZP | credit | 2 | 2 lecture hours (45 min) of instruction per week, 29 to 39 hours of self-study | English, Czech | summer |
Subject guarantor
Name of lecturer(s)
Department
The subject provides Department of Audiovisual Studies
Contents
Introductory programming course. Basic concepts and procedures will be explained using Python. This introduction will provide sufficient background knowledge to take more advanced programming courses directly related to their artistic practice. Throughout the course, students will be introduced to basic concepts, methods, and concepts such as variables, arrays, conditions, loops, functions, and more.
Learning outcomes
Students will understand the basic concepts, concepts and practices of programming.
Prerequisites and other requirements
none specified
Literature
MATTHES, Eric. Python Crash Course: A Hands-On, Project-Based Introduction to Programming. San Francisco: No Starch Press, 2015. 560 p. ISBN 978-1593276034.
Evaluation methods and criteria
Active participation, independently prepared assignment
Note
-
Further information
No schedule has been prepared for this course
The subject is a part of the following study plans
- Audiovisual Studies - Bachelor_2020 (Required subjects)
- Audiovisual Studies - Master 2024 (Elective subjects)